I'm having problems with the wall and dome line separation. I'll probably end up using some tape to paint straight lines whenever it dries out.

Colors used (so I won't forget):
  • Light-salmon/crimsom base: burnt sienna (4/5) + titan red (1/5) + white + turps
  • Grey on top, and left: phthalo blue + black + red + ocher or white
  • Yellow on center: ocher + crimsom layer with lots of turps
  • Dark surroundings: crimsom + burnt umber
